This function contains the general set of actions that are always used when recoding a source (e.g. check the input, document the justification, etc). Users should normally never call this function.

Arguments
- input
One of 1) a character string specifying the path to a file with a source; 2) an object with a loaded source as produced by a call to
load_source()
; 3) a character string specifying the path to a directory containing one or more sources; 4) or an object with a list of loaded sources as produced by a call toload_sources()
.- codes
The codes to process
- func
The function to apply.
- filenameRegex
Only process files matching this regular expression.
- filter
Optionally, a filter to apply to specify a subset of the source(s) to process (see
get_source_filter()
).- output
If specified, the coded source will be written here.
- outputPrefix, outputSuffix
The prefix and suffix to add to the filenames when writing the processed files to disk, in case multiple sources are passed as input.
- decisionLabel
A description of the (recoding) decision that was taken.
- justification
The justification for this action.
- justificationFile
If specified, the justification is appended to this file. If not, it is saved to the
justifier::workspace()
. This can then be saved or displayed at the end of the R Markdown file or R script usingjustifier::save_workspace()
.- preventOverwriting
Whether to prevent overwriting existing files when writing the files to
output
.- encoding
The encoding to use.
- silent
Whether to be chatty or quiet.
- ...
Other arguments to pass to
fnc
.
